Output 73449634a91ed10a0e0c2b81ad62479b4d8cfbf70167dec15a8f621eaa8e581a:2

value
280331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ae62cc1cb80228c249dd644b3f717bcf5f1f4a6f OP_EQUAL
address
2N99HvDihzkNHYPzd3N3VwV6BAkUPCQruPy
transaction
73449634a91ed10a0e0c2b81ad62479b4d8cfbf70167dec15a8f621eaa8e581a
confirmations
102550
spent
true